Transaction 68051dd7bd924abffb41ad349f0d334d22e3bb1ba7eae7b34982bc7385191694
1 Input
1 Output
-
68051dd7bd924abffb41ad349f0d334d22e3bb1ba7eae7b34982bc7385191694:0
- value
- 1775901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8103dfcc674de177d2f5419e8ad1274384769f01 OP_EQUAL
- address
- 3DTBjUVoU4kMPxJevoVUoykoYeYRCig79K